Comparing Action Observation and Motor Imagery Training: A Two-Week Intervention on Squat Vertical Jump Performance

This randomized, three-arm study compared the effects of action observation (AO) and motor imagery (MI), each delivered as a brief 10-second pre-movement stimulus, on squat vertical jump (SVJ) performance in healthy novice adults, against a control condition, over a two-week, six-session programme. For every jump, an unstimulated basic jump and a post-stimulus jump were recorded with an Optojump optical system, and the cognitive-stimulus effect was quantified as the difference between them.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Action Observation (AO)
Before each jump, participants watched a standardized 10-second video of a model performing the squat vertical jump.
linked to Arm 1 > Ten-second observation of a video model performing the squat vertical jump immediately before each jump.
Experimental: Motor Imagery (MI)
Before each jump, participants performed 10 seconds of third-person (external) visual motor imagery of the squat vertical jump.
linked to Arm 2 > Ten-second third-person visual motor imagery of the squat vertical jump immediately before each jump.
No Intervention: Control
Before each jump, participants viewed a blank black screen for 10 seconds with no imagery or observation.

Cognitive-stimulus effect on squat vertical jump height
Time Frame: Each of six sessions across two weeks
Within-session difference between the post-stimulus jump height and the unstimulated basic jump height (post-stimulus minus basic jump), in centimetres, measured with an Optojump optical system
